A parkour movement overhaul for Minecraft Bedrock built around speed, momentum, wall movement, rolls, dodges, and chaining moves together.

Flow Edition uses your normal movement controls contextually, keeping parkour fast and natural without assigning a separate button to every action.

The goal is simple:

Keep moving.


Mark of the Shinobi (Equip it to begin your training.)

Ninja Parkour is activated by the Mark of the Shinobi.

Equip the Mark in your offhand / shield slot to enable the movement system.

A small glowing red Shinobi emblem appears on your chest while active.

Remove the Mark to return to normal Minecraft movement.

Shadow Rush (Ninja Sprint, faster movement built for parkour.)

Sprint forward and maintain your run.

After a short build-up, Shadow Rush engages automatically and shifts you into Ninja Sprint.

While active:

There is no vault button.

If the terrain is suitable, vaulting happens naturally as part of the run.

Keep holding Forward to maintain Shadow Rush.

Release Forward to disengage.

While airborne, Shadow Rush also surrounds you in shadow mist.

Void Step (Double jump, take your momentum higher.)

Perform a normal jump, then:

Release Jump → Press Jump again while airborne

Void Step gives you another burst of height while preserving your movement.

Use it to extend gaps, reach higher terrain, adjust your route, or set up a wall movement.

Ghost Run (Wall Run, walls are just floors with worse marketing.)

To start a Wall Run:

If those conditions are met, you automatically transition into a Wall Run.

Once attached, you can freely move your camera without losing the wall.

Control Action
Jump Kick away from the wall
Sneak Drop from the wall
Keep moving along the wall Continue the Wall Run
Reach the end of the wall Release naturally

Press Jump to Wall Kick forward, upward, and away from the wall.

The kick follows your current Wall Run direction, making it useful for clearing gaps or transitioning toward another wall.

Shadow Grip (Wall Catch, when reaching the wall was only half the plan.)

Shadow Grip is a deliberate wall catch performed after your Double Jump.

Jump → Release → Jump → Release → Jump and HOLD

The third Jump press arms the wall catch.

Keep Jump held while airborne and reach a nearby valid wall to catch it.

While attached, you slowly slide downward until you release Jump or lose contact.

Launching From the Wall

Release Jump to launch.

Look mostly up the wall for a stronger upward launch.

Look toward another route to launch in that direction instead.

You also retain brief aerial steering after release.

Shinobi Roll (Safety Roll, landing is part of the route.)

While airborne:

Hold Sneak through the landing

A suitable landing converts into a forward safety roll instead of stopping your movement.

The roll carries your incoming momentum and can travel several blocks.

Keep Sneak held to continue.

Release it to finish normally.

The roll can also carry over an edge instead of Sneak stopping you at the block.

Shinobi Burst (Roll Launch, keep the momentum going.)

During an active Shinobi Roll:

Press Jump

The roll immediately converts into a powerful forward and upward launch.

Shinobi Burst preserves your incoming momentum and adds another burst on top.

Shadow Dodge (Directional dodge, reposition in an instant.)

Quickly double-tap a movement direction while grounded.

Shadow Dodge works with:

Forward is left alone so normal Sprint activation is not interrupted.

A successful dodge rapidly moves you in the chosen direction and can travel roughly 4 blocks, stopping early if terrain blocks the route.

The active dodge also includes a brief window of protection.

Side and diagonal dodges can preserve Ninja Sprint.

A strong backward retreat can cancel it.

Mist Run (Water traversal, keep the run alive.)

Carry an active Ninja Sprint onto water while maintaining your movement.

With enough momentum, the run continues across the surface instead of dropping into a normal swim.

There is no Water Run button or special toggle.

Just keep moving.

Quick Control Reference

What You Want To Do Input
Enable Ninja Parkour Equip Mark of the Shinobi in your offhand / shield slot
Disable Ninja Parkour Remove the Mark
Activate Ninja Sprint Sprint forward and maintain your run
Vault suitable terrain Automatic during Ninja Sprint
Double Jump Jump → Release → Jump again while airborne
Enter Wall Run Ninja Sprint + airborne + approach a valid wall at an angle
Wall Kick Jump while Wall Running
Drop from Wall Run Sneak while Wall Running
Wall Catch After Double Jump: Release → press Jump again and HOLD until you reach a wall
Launch from Wall Catch Release Jump while latched
Safety Roll Hold Sneak through landing
Roll Launch Press Jump during a Roll
Shadow Dodge While grounded, quickly double-tap a movement direction
Water Run Carry active Ninja Sprint onto water
